Title: Sweet & sour pork kabobs
Categories: Pork
Yield: 4 Servings
md Carrots -- cut 1" pieces
1/4 c Red wine vinegar
1 tb Soy sauce
1 ts Sugar
12 oz Lean boneless pork --
1 "pieces
Sweet red pepper --
1 "squares
8 oz Can pineapple slices
1 tb Cooking oil
1 1/2 ts Cornstarch
Garlic clove -- minced
Sm green pepper -- 1" squares
Cut carrots, pork, green and sweet red pepper into 1" pieces. In a
saucepan, cook carrots, covered, in a small amount of boiling water
for 8 minutes; drain well. Drain pineapple, reserving juice. Cut
pineapple slices into quarters; set aside. For sauce, in a saucepan
combine reserved pineapple juice, vinegar, oil, soy sauce,
cornstarch, sugar, and garlic. Cook and stir till thickened and
bubbly. Cook and stir 1-2 minutes more. Thread cooked carrots,
pineapple, green and red pepper, and pork on four 12-14" skewers,
leaving 1/4" between each piece of food. Grill kabobs on an uncovered
grill directly over medium-hot coals for 8-12 minutes or till pork is
no longer pink. (or, broil 4-5" from the heat for 15-18 minutes.)
Turn kabobs occasionally and brush often with sauce.
Per serving: 250 calories, 22 g protein, 18 g carbohydrates, 10 g
fat, 62 mg cholesterol, 322 mg sodium, 560 mg potassium
